Pat Pottle
British peace campaigner Pat Pottle, a founder member of anti-war group The Committee of 100, during his trial at the Old Bailey in London, 19th February 1962. The trial is in connection with his role in the 1961 demonstration at USAF Wethersfield in Essex. Pottle and five others were sentenced to 18 months' imprisonment.
